Fair Game

(idiomatic) An acceptable subject of criticism, scrutiny, or mockery.

Example :   Pretending to be slow is fair game. Pretending to be injured is not.  The referee ruled the unprecedented play fair game.  After the middle sister's call from a friend's house, her slice of cake was fair game.  Anyone running for office is fair game for criticism.Used other than as an idiom: see fair,‎ game.: a game that is fair, that does not involve cheating, etc.
